Quiz Cam, Sept. 19, 2011: Ridgewood tries for the double H's
By

Episode 14: Join quizmaster Ryan Greene on the streets of Ridgewood with a brainteaser about Bergen's towns with common consonants

THE QUESTION:  There are six towns in Bergen County with at least two 'H's in the name. List them.

THE ANSWER: (scroll down)

 





 

 

 

THE ANSWER:  The towns are: Hasbrouck Heights, Haworth, Ho-Ho-Kus, Mahwah, South Hackensack and Washington Township.
